Out-of-service rates vs. national average

An out-of-service order means the driver or vehicle was pulled from operation during a roadside inspection.

Driver OOS rate0.0%
National average5.5%
Vehicle OOS rate33.3%
National average20.7%

For reference, the average driver OOS rate in Minnesota is 8.8% and the average vehicle OOS rate is 32.4% across 74,268 carriers.
